Mick Schumacher can hope for a Formula 1 comeback for the 2026 season.
RTL/NTV and sport.de can confirm the information reported by other media, according to which the 26-year-old son of record world champion Michael Schumacher is a candidate at the new US racing team Cadillac. The team will enter the motorsport king class in the coming year.

Schumacher described Cadillac on the edge of the Miami GPS at “Sky” as a “exciting project” at the weekend. In addition to him, however, ex-Sauer driver Guanyu Zhou can also also have hopes for an introduction to the racing team.
Schumacher fueled the rumors about a Cadillac interest on Saturday with a visit to the Cadillac launch party at the Queen Miami Beach. The Alpine factory pilot in the WEC shook a few hands and enjoyed the evening.
On the racing weekend there was also discussions with those responsible for the team, such as RTL/NTV and sport.de can confirm.
